repo.or.cz
/
wine
/
testsucceed.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
wined3d: Remove a redundant check from basetexture_get_autogen_filter_type().
2009-08-05
St
e
fan
Dö
s
inger
wine
d
3d:
E
nab
l
e WINED3DFMT_R16G16B16A16_UNOR
M
.
commit
|
commitdiff
|
tree
2009-08-05
S
tef
a
n D
ö
singe
r
wined3d: Prel
o
ad the correct texture
l
oca
t
ion
.
commit
|
commitdiff
|
tree
2009-08-05
Stefan Dösinger
w
i
ned3d: Only us
e
WINE
_
norm
a
lized_texrect if
A
R
B_
t
exture_np2
.
.
.
commit
|
commitdiff
|
tree
2009-08-05
Stefan Dösinger
wined3d: AR
B
clipplane init needs t
h
e helper constant
.
commit
|
commitdiff
|
tree
2009-07-20
Ste
f
an Dösinger
w
i
ned3d: S
e
t the
h
ighest dirty
m
arker afte
r
m
a
rking
.
.
.
commit
|
commitdiff
|
tree
2009-07-20
Ste
f
an Dösinger
wined3d: Don't activate a context un
l
ess we need one
.
commit
|
commitdiff
|
tree
2009-07-16
S
tefan Dösi
n
ger
wined3d: Use the unmod
i
fied sour
c
e in MOVA
.
commit
|
commitdiff
|
tree
2009-07-16
Stefan
D
ösinger
wine
d
3d:
D
on't call glGetError if no
b
ody is li
s
tening
.
commit
|
commitdiff
|
tree
2009-07-15
Stefan D
ö
singer
wined3d: Set the
depth blit helper t
e
xture address
.
.
.
commit
|
commitdiff
|
tree
2009-07-15
Stefan Dösinge
r
wine
d
3d:
EXP an
d
E
X
PP are scalar ope
r
a
tions
.
commit
|
commitdiff
|
tree
2009-07-10
St
e
fa
n
Dösi
n
ger
wined3d: Check the correct constant limit
.
commit
|
commitdiff
|
tree
2009-07-10
Stefan Dösinger
wined3d: Drop the
c
olor0 mov optimiza
t
ion if the s
r
c
.
.
.
commit
|
commitdiff
|
tree
2009-07-10
St
e
fan Dö
s
ing
e
r
wined3d: Only use 4
c
omponent specular colo
r
s if GL
.
.
.
commit
|
commitdiff
|
tree
2009-07-09
S
tefa
n
Dösing
e
r
w
ined3d: Updat
e
N
v
idia dr
i
ver
v
ersions
.
commit
|
commitdiff
|
tree
2009-07-09
Stefan
D
ösi
n
ger
win
e
d3d: Add
I
ntel GMA
X3100 t
o
our card DB
.
commit
|
commitdiff
|
tree
2009-07-09
Stefan Dösinger
w
ined3d: An indirect address op ca
n
ad
j
ust
m
in and
.
.
.
commit
|
commitdiff
|
tree
2009-07-01
Stefan
D
ösinger
wined
3
d: Don't dir
t
i
f
y
t
o
o many shader
con
s
tan
t
s
.
commit
|
commitdiff
|
tree
2009-06-29
Stefan Dösinger
wined3d: Add
a
NOP ret ha
n
dler
t
o GLSL
.
commit
|
commitdiff
|
tree
2009-06-29
S
tefan D
ö
singer
wined3d: Ad
d
th
e
vertex sh
a
der fo
o
ter in the main function
.
commit
|
commitdiff
|
tree
2009-06-29
St
e
fan
D
ösinger
w
ined3d: Write the vshader footer
in
a separate fun
c
t
i
on
.
commit
|
commitdiff
|
tree
2009-06-29
S
t
e
f
an Dösing
e
r
win
e
d3d: Im
p
lement
function calls with
N
V exts
.
commit
|
commitdiff
|
tree
2009-06-29
Stefan Dö
s
i
n
ger
wined3d: ARB*p is
a
lready on afte
r
a depth blit
.
commit
|
commitdiff
|
tree
2009-06-29
Stefan Dösinger
wined3d: D
o
n't
d
is
a
ble ARBfp if t
h
e replace
m
ent p
i
peline
.
.
.
commit
|
commitdiff
|
tree
2009-06-29
Stefan Dösing
e
r
win
e
d3d: Only u
p
date the screen when the frontbuf
f
e
r
.
.
.
commit
|
commitdiff
|
tree
2009-06-26
S
t
efan Dösinge
r
wined3d: Hon
o
r W
I
NED3DSPS
M
_NOT
in ARB
.
commit
|
commitdiff
|
tree
2009-06-26
Stefan Dösinger
w
ined3d: Jump
to the el
s
e bran
c
h
if
cond is false,
.
.
.
commit
|
commitdiff
|
tree
2009-06-26
Stefan
D
ösin
g
e
r
w
ined3d: Support wr
i
temas
k
s on
texkill in ARB
.
commit
|
commitdiff
|
tree
2009-06-26
Stefan
D
ösinger
win
e
d3d: Initia
l
ize the
u
se
d
cli
p
plane
s
even if
n
o
.
.
.
commit
|
commitdiff
|
tree
2009-06-26
S
t
e
fan Dösinger
w
ined3d
:
Unclamp vertex color
s
for 3
.
0 s
h
aders in ARB
.
.
.
commit
|
commitdiff
|
tree
2009-06-26
Stefan Dös
i
nger
wi
n
e
d3d: POW and LO
G
o
p
erate
o
n th
e
ab
s
o
l
u
t
e value
.
commit
|
commitdiff
|
tree
2009-06-26
Stefan Dösinger
wi
n
ed3d:
I
FC
requires GL_NV_f
r
a
g
ment_program2
.
commit
|
commitdiff
|
tree
2009-06-26
Stefan Dösing
e
r
wi
n
ed3d: B
e
war
e
of doubl
e
negatio
n
s
.
commit
|
commitdiff
|
tree
2009-06-26
S
tefan Dö
s
inger
winebuild: Open resource f
i
les in bin
a
r
y m
o
de
.
commit
|
commitdiff
|
tree
2009-06-23
S
tefan Dösinger
wined3d: Fix pixelshader ifc
.
commit
|
commitdiff
|
tree
2009-06-23
S
t
efan
Dö
s
inger
wined
3
d
:
Use a local par
a
met
e
r for the position fixup
.
commit
|
commitdiff
|
tree
2009-06-23
Stefa
n
Dös
i
ng
e
r
w
ined3d:
Find the
c
lip texcoord before compiling
.
commit
|
commitdiff
|
tree
2009-06-23
St
e
fan D
ö
singer
win
e
d3d: Add
a f
u
nct
i
on to control u
s
e of NV_vp
2
cl
i
pplanes
.
commit
|
commitdiff
|
tree
2009-06-23
Stefan Dösinger
wined3d
:
Don't emulate
cl
i
pplanes w
i
th f
f
p vp and fix
.
.
.
commit
|
commitdiff
|
tree
2009-06-22
Stefan Dösinger
wined3d: GLSL
1
.
20 inc
l
udes
gl_
F
ragData[] syntax
.
commit
|
commitdiff
|
tree
2009-06-22
Stefan Dö
s
inger
w
i
ned3d: Advertise SM 3
.
0
in ARB if the extensi
o
ns
.
.
.
commit
|
commitdiff
|
tree
2009-06-22
Ste
f
a
n Dösinger
wined3d: Enable Sh
a
der Model 2
.
0 in ARB
.
commit
|
commitdiff
|
tree
2009-06-22
Ste
f
an Dösin
g
er
w
ined3d: Make th
e
A
R
B inde
x
offset w
o
r
k w
i
th emulat
e
d
.
.
.
commit
|
commitdiff
|
tree
2009-06-22
S
tefan Dösinger
w
i
ned3d
:
XXXC CC do
e
sn't wo
r
k even
w
ith NV_FP2 on
.
commit
|
commitdiff
|
tree
2009-06-22
Stefan
Dösinger
win
e
d3d
:
Implement MRTs in AR
B
.
commit
|
commitdiff
|
tree
2009-06-22
Stefan Dös
i
nger
wined3d:
R
eload
t
he first 8 constants
on
a
1
.
x and
.
.
.
commit
|
commitdiff
|
tree
2009-06-22
S
t
efa
n
Dösinger
d
3
d9: Add
a
SGN tes
t
.
commit
|
commitdiff
|
tree
2009-06-22
S
t
e
f
an Dösinge
r
d3d9
:
Add
a
n aL indexing test
.
commit
|
commitdiff
|
tree
2009-06-22
S
t
ef
a
n Dösi
n
g
e
r
wined
3
d: In
v
a
lidate
the srgb tex in surface::unload
.
commit
|
commitdiff
|
tree
2009-06-10
Stefan
Dösinger
wi
n
ed3d:
Don't
s
et unloade
d
arrays
t
o zero
.
commit
|
commitdiff
|
tree
2009-06-10
Stefan Dösinger
wined3d:
A
small a
t
ifs bump map improvement
.
commit
|
commitdiff
|
tree
2009-06-10
Stef
a
n Dösinger
w
i
ned3d:
Implem
e
nt
d
sy
in ARB
.
commit
|
commitdiff
|
tree
2009-06-10
S
t
efan
D
ö
s
i
n
ger
wined3d: Implement loops
w
ith the NV
e
xtensions
.
commit
|
commitdiff
|
tree
2009-06-10
Stefan Dösinger
w
i
ned3d: Store the bumpma
p
A
R
B constants in ARB st
r
u
c
tures
.
commit
|
commitdiff
|
tree
2009-06-02
S
t
efan Dös
i
n
ger
wined3d: Implem
e
nt cl
i
pplanes in
t
he A
R
B
bac
k
e
nd
.
commit
|
commitdiff
|
tree
2009-06-02
Stefan Dö
s
inger
wined3d
:
Upd
a
te clipplanes
on a shader-f
i
x
ed
funct
i
on
.
.
.
commit
|
commitdiff
|
tree
2009-06-02
S
tefan D
ö
singer
wined3d: Use con
d
i
t
i
on c
o
d
e for sRGB write correction
.
.
.
commit
|
commitdiff
|
tree
2009-06-02
Stef
a
n Dö
s
inger
w
i
n
ed
3
d: Handle LR
P
in
vertex shaders
.
commit
|
commitdiff
|
tree
2009-06-01
Stefan Dösinger
wined3d: Add
a
co
m
ment about texbem and X2D
.
commit
|
commitdiff
|
tree
2009-06-01
S
t
e
fan Dös
i
nger
wined
3
d: Don't enabl
e
the
N
V fr
a
g exte
n
sions
i
f we
.
.
.
commit
|
commitdiff
|
tree
2009-06-01
Stefan Dösinger
w
i
ned3d: Write
r
esult
.
color
in one mov
.
commit
|
commitdiff
|
tree
2009-06-01
Stefan Dösi
n
g
e
r
wi
n
ed3d: Revert "WineD3D: use CMP instead of SL
T
and
.
.
.
commit
|
commitdiff
|
tree
2009-06-01
Stefan Dösinger
w
ined3d:
U
se
Rx registers
for sRGB correction if possible
.
commit
|
commitdiff
|
tree
2009-05-29
Stef
a
n
Dösinger
wined3d: Use
NRM from GL_NV_fr
a
gment_progra
m
2 if availa
b
l
e
.
commit
|
commitdiff
|
tree
2009-05-29
Stefan D
ö
singer
wine
d
3d: A
v
oid
the TM
P
_COLOR mov in some ca
s
es
.
commit
|
commitdiff
|
tree
2009-05-29
Ste
f
an Dösinger
wined3d
:
Use
DP2A or X2D for dp2add if available
.
commit
|
commitdiff
|
tree
2009-05-29
Stefan Dösinger
wined3d: R
e
move a
MESA h
a
ck
.
commit
|
commitdiff
|
tree
2009-05-29
Stefan Dösinger
w
i
ned3d
:
Alloca
t
e the proper size for the lconst map
.
commit
|
commitdiff
|
tree
2009-05-28
S
t
efan Dös
i
n
ger
win
e
d3d:
Emulate if(bool) in ARB shaders
.
commit
|
commitdiff
|
tree
2009-05-28
St
e
f
an Dös
i
ng
e
r
wined
3
d: Add
a f
u
n
ctio
n
ar
o
u
nd
the handler table
.
commit
|
commitdiff
|
tree
2009-05-28
Ste
f
an Dösi
n
ger
wine
d
3d: Manage vs_comp
i
le_args in the
b
acken
d
s
.
commit
|
commitdiff
|
tree
2009-05-28
Stef
a
n D
ö
singer
wined3d:
Ma
n
age ps_compile
d
_shader
in the backends
.
commit
|
commitdiff
|
tree
2009-05-28
Stefan
D
ö
singer
wined3d: Make
find_gl_vshader backen
d
specif
i
c
.
commit
|
commitdiff
|
tree
2009-05-28
St
e
fan Dösi
n
g
er
wined3d: Remove the forward
d
eclaration added in t
h
e
.
.
.
commit
|
commitdiff
|
tree
2009-05-28
Stef
a
n
D
ösinger
wined3d: Mak
e
fi
n
d_gl_p
s
hader b
a
ckend private
.
commit
|
commitdiff
|
tree
2009-05-28
Stefan
Dösinger
wined3d:
S
tore the compile args in th
e
c
o
mpile cont
e
x
t
.
.
.
commit
|
commitdiff
|
tree
2009-05-27
St
e
f
a
n
Dösinge
r
wined3d: Work
around an ARBFP vs GLSL bug in Mac OS
.
commit
|
commitdiff
|
tree
2009-05-27
Stefan Dö
s
inger
wined3d: s
i
ncos
for ve
r
te
x
shaders
.
commit
|
commitdiff
|
tree
2009-05-27
Stefa
n
Dösi
n
g
e
r
wine
d
3d: Put some ARB declara
t
ions in the r
i
ght place
.
commit
|
commitdiff
|
tree
2009-05-27
Stefan Dösinger
wined3d: G
e
t
rid of
Tx hardcoding in tex
b
e
m
.
commit
|
commitdiff
|
tree
2009-05-27
Stefan Dösi
n
ger
wined3d: Replace a few hard
c
oded Tx regis
t
ers with
.
.
.
commit
|
commitdiff
|
tree
2009-05-27
Stefan Dösin
g
er
wined3d: Implement DSX in AR
B
.
commit
|
commitdiff
|
tree
2009-05-21
Stefan Dösinger
wined3d: Implement SGN in ARB
.
commit
|
commitdiff
|
tree
2009-05-21
Stefan Dös
i
nge
r
wined3d: Support v
e
c4 A0 with
N
V_vertex_program2_option
.
commit
|
commitdiff
|
tree
2009-05-21
S
t
efan Dösinger
wined3d: Sup
p
ort ABS and
A
B
SNEG with NV extensions
.
.
.
commit
|
commitdiff
|
tree
2009-05-21
Stefan Dö
s
inger
w
i
ned3d:
A
d
d
NV
as
m
e
x
t
e
n
s
ion support to the
ARB
backen
d
.
commit
|
commitdiff
|
tree
2009-05-21
Ste
f
an Dös
i
nge
r
wined3d
:
Su
p
port ABS and
A
BSNEG in ARB
.
commit
|
commitdiff
|
tree
2009-05-20
St
e
fan
D
ösinge
r
wined3d: Emulate the 4 component ad
d
ress regi
s
ter in
.
.
.
commit
|
commitdiff
|
tree
2009-05-20
Stefan Dösinger
win
e
d
3d: Prepare for vec4 address registers in ARB
.
commit
|
commitdiff
|
tree
2009-05-20
S
t
e
fan Dösinger
wi
n
ed3d: I
m
p
l
e
ment
mova
r
o
u
ndin
g
in arb
.
commit
|
commitdiff
|
tree
2009-05-20
St
e
f
an Dösinger
wined3d: Fix srgb correct
i
on
.
commit
|
commitdiff
|
tree
2009-05-20
Stefan Dösinger
w
ined3d: Get rid
of the TMP register in fragment shader
s
.
commit
|
commitdiff
|
tree
2009-05-19
Stefan Dös
i
ng
e
r
w
i
ne
d
3d: Use CMP ins
t
ead o
f
SL
T
a
nd SGE i
n
sRGB correction
.
commit
|
commitdiff
|
tree
2009-05-19
S
tefan D
ö
s
inger
wined3d: Ge
t
rid of TMP accesses i
n
te
x
m3x3* ins
t
r
u
ctio
n
s
.
commit
|
commitdiff
|
tree
2009-05-19
Stefan Dösinger
wined3d: Get ri
d
of TM
P
acces
s
i
n
texm3x
2
*
.
commit
|
commitdiff
|
tree
2009-05-19
Stefa
n
Dösinger
wi
n
e
d
3d: Get ri
d
of TMP2 a
n
d
s
ome easy
TMP
r
e
g
i
s
ter
.
.
.
commit
|
commitdiff
|
tree
2009-05-19
Stefan Dö
s
ing
e
r
wined3d: Only declare T
M
P
_
OUT in vertex sha
d
ers
.
commit
|
commitdiff
|
tree
2009-05-18
Stefan Dösi
n
ger
WineD3D:
Su
p
port more constants
in AR
B
s
haders
.
commit
|
commitdiff
|
tree
2009-05-18
St
e
fan Dö
s
inger
wi
n
ed3d:
A
void declaring helper_const in vertex progr
a
ms
.
.
.
commit
|
commitdiff
|
tree
2009-05-18
Stefan Dö
s
inger
wined3d: Support cli
p
plane
s
w
i
th
G
L
S
L
.
commit
|
commitdiff
|
tree
2009-05-18
S
t
ef
a
n Dös
i
nger
win
e
d
3
d
: Update the b
u
m
p
constants after a s
h
ader chan
g
e
.
commit
|
commitdiff
|
tree
next